How Laminate Floor Water Extraction Actually Works

When water seeps beneath your laminate floor, it’s not just a matter of drying the surface. The water can penetrate deep into the subfloor, damaging the underlying wood and creating an ideal environment for mold growth. That’s why our team takes a comprehensive approach to laminate floor water extraction, using specialized equipment to extract the water, dry the area, and prevent further damage. Laminate Floor Water Extraction Cost in Grand Prairie, TX

The cost of laminate floor water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Grand Prairie, TX.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, type of water damage, and equipment needed.
Moisture Readings $100 – $500 Number of readings required, complexity of the affected area.
Drying $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and duration of the drying process.
Dehumidification $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and duration of the dehumidification process.
Final Inspection $100 – $500 Complexity of the affected area, number of inspections required.
